Playa del Carmen, Q.R. — Six people are currently in police custody for the murder of a Playa del Carmen kidnapping victim. Police were made aware of a shooting on a backroad into the Xcalacoco area of north PDC late Friday morning.

At the scene police located a yellow car left behind by the driver during a pursuit by his alleged kidnappers. When the driver of the car crashed-stopped into a tree, his pursuers shot him, removed him from his vehicle and forced him into theirs.
The getaway vehicle was last seen heading up the federal 307 highway toward Cancun. Police intercepted two vehicles described used in the kidnapping, one of which was transporting the victim.
The victim, an adult male, was found dead inside the getaway car. A second vehicle, a van painted as a laundry service vehicle, was also intercepted. According to available information, the van acted as a pilot vehicle for the getaway car transporting the kidnapped man.

Early Friday afternoon, police reported on the arrests of five men and one woman involved in the kidnapping and subsequent death of the man. According to the State Attorney General (FGE), the kidnapping was a clash between rival criminal groups.
Police have identified those captured as José Guadalupe “N”, Luis Alfonso “N”, Ángel “N”, Cristopher “N”, Ángel Eduardo “N” and Consuelo “N”. The were captured after a chase with police. Several of those arrested were reported injured.

In a statement, the Secretariat of Citizen Security (SSC) and the Attorney General’s Office (FGE) of the State of Quintana Roo reported “a confrontation between two groups of armed individuals occurred on Federal Highway 307 near Xcalacoco.
“Upon arriving at the scene, municipal police officers, with support from the Peacebuilding Coordination Group, seized a vehicle, which inside a deceased person was found. As a result of the intervention, six people allegedly involved in these incidents were arrested and three firearms were seized,” they said.

In a separate statement, the FGE reported “on the initiation of an investigation stemming from the arrest of six people, five men and one woman, by the Municipal Police of this district, for their probable involvement in the crime of aggravated homicide against a man whose identity is reserved.
“The detainees are José Guadalupe “N”, Luis Alfonso “N”, Ángel “N”, Cristopher “N”, Ángel Eduardo “N” and Consuelo “N”. At the time of their capture, the suspects were seized with three handguns and three vehicles.

Initial investigations link the detainees to being members of a violent criminal group dedicated to the sale and distribution of drugs in the municipality. They are also being investigated for their alleged involvement in a homicide that occurred on April 2 of this year inside a bar in the city.

“Following their arrest, the five men and the woman, along with the seized evidence, were handed over to the Public Prosecutor’s Office. Authorities from all levels of government are working in a coordinated manner to bring lawbreakers to justice.
